// Adds dimensions UUID, Author and Topic into GA4
Saturday, June 20, 2026
28.9 C
Singapore

Singapore Government Bans Foreign Preachers Mufti Menk and Haslin Baharim, Citing Divisive Teachings; Netizens React

Singapore’s Ministry of Home Affairs has banned two foreign preachers, Mufti Ismail Menk and Haslin Baharim, from entering the nation.

Both preachers, who were due to preach on a religious-themed cruise departing and concluding in Singapore from 25-29 Nov, have been rejected from preaching in Singapore previously.

Announcing the decision in a statement today, MHA said: “They will not be allowed to get around the ban by preaching instead on cruise ships which operate to and from Singapore.”

The Ministry reported that the ban was instated following consultation with the Islamic Religious Council of Singapore (MUIS), Singapore Tourism Board and Maritime and Port Authority of Singapore.

Mufti Menk has been known to preach “segregationist and divisive teachings,” such as teaching that it is a sin and crime for a Muslim to wish a non-Muslim Merry Christmas or Happy Deepavali.

Haslin has also taught views promoting disharmony between Muslims and non-Muslims, whom he has described as “deviant.”

The MHA asserted: “Such divisive views breed intolerance and exclusivist practices that will damage social harmony, and cause communities to drift apart. They are unacceptable in the context of Singapore’s multi-racial and multi-religious society.”

It added that such teachings are “detrimental to our society and way of life, and will undermine the fundamentals of Singapore’s peace and progress.”

Netizens responding to news of the ban imposed upon the preachers have been divided. Some have called the preachers out for being extremists, while others have claimed that Mufti Menk, in particular, preaches peace:

mmplus1 mmplus2

mmneg1 mmneg2 mmneg3 mmneg4

In 2016, Home Affairs and Law Minister Mr K Shanmugam, appeared to allude to Mufti Menk when he explained why certain foreign preachers are prohibited from coming to Singapore.

“Foreign preachers are sometimes not allowed to come to Singapore to preach. Why?  We will not allow anyone of any religion who preaches that people of other faiths should be shunned or that people of other faiths should be ignored. And it’s not only what he preaches in Singapore. We will also look at what he preaches outside Singapore. Because his speeches could be available online and it will be wrong for us to allow him to build-up his following in Singapore.
The Government will not interfere in doctrinal matters within each religion. But the Government has to step-in to protect our racial, religious harmony. We cannot allow someone to preach values which are contrary to our multi-cultural, multi-ethnic harmony. we take a firm, clear stand on that.”

Mufti Menk’s Singaporean followers had however showed their support for him on Facebook.

Read also:

Was Minister Shanmugam’s speech directed at preachers like Mufti Menk? | The Independent Singapore News 

Calvin Cheng says the way Raffles Hall alumni association speakers replaced was cowardly – Singapore News 

MHA: 2 radicalised Singaporeans detained for planning to join IS – Singapore News 

- Advertisement -

Hot this week

Good news for SG workers from MOM: Singapore public holidays have 5 long weekends next year, falling on Fri, Sun or Mon; 11 PH...

New Year's Day, Chinese New Year, Good Friday, Hari Raya Haji and National Day help create five long weekends for Singapore workers in 2027

New mandatory coastal protection guidelines for Singapore landowners launched; sea levels projected to rise by 2.15 m

Coastal property owners will need to plan and maintain flood protection measures as Singapore steps up efforts to prepare for rising sea levels

Popular Categories

document.addEventListener("DOMContentLoaded", () => { const trigger = document.getElementById("ads-trigger"); if ('IntersectionObserver' in window && trigger) { const observer = new IntersectionObserver((entries, observer) => { entries.forEach(entry => { if (entry.isIntersecting) { lazyLoader(); // You should define lazyLoader() elsewhere or inline here observer.unobserve(entry.target); // Run once } }); }, { rootMargin: '800px', threshold: 0.1 }); observer.observe(trigger); } else { // Fallback setTimeout(lazyLoader, 3000); } });
// //
Enable Notifications OK No thanks